Milo Ventimiglia is one of many who lost their home in the devastating LA wildfires. CBS Evening News was with the actor as he tearfully came to check on his home, where he and his wife, Jarah Mariano, have been preparing to welcome their first child together.
As he drove to the Malibu property in a segment aired on Thursday, he saw it all burnt to the ground, remarking, “Wow, man. Toast.” Oof.
